申論題 (4)
一、Please describe the current main institutions under the European Union and their functions; and analyze the results of the European Parliament election in June 2024 and its impact on European integration. (20 points)
二、Please explain the balance of power theory and use such theory to explain how Ukraine attempted to counter Russia’s intervention through internal and external balancing before the outbreak of the 2022 Russia-Ukraine war. (20 points)
三、What was the background of the Sino-Russian treaty of 1896? What was the primary motivation of the Qing Court? Was the treaty in the interest of China at that time? (17 points)
